Aller au contenu

Sujets conseillés

Posté (modifié)

Bonjour à tous,

Ceci une demande un peu particulière:

Je suis enseignant en conception multimédia aux Arts Décoratifs de Genève, et dans la cadre de ma formation professionnelle, je dois réaliser un court mémoire sur un sujet pédagogique (pour être titularisé comme on dit chez nous en france).

Comme j'enseigne dans une section à vocation créative, ou l'approche des techniques est largement intuitive et non scientifique, j'ai rencontré quelques difficultés à populariser la programmation (Actionscript, Lingo et PHP) auprès d'adolescents plus artistes que codeurs.

Mon sujet porte sur l'élaboration d'une méthode allégée d'enseignement de la programmation adaptée à des "artistes" qui leur permettrait entre autres :

1) d'atteindre une certaine autonomie par rapport à cette discipline

2) de développer une passion pour la programmation "créative"

3) de comprendre l'architecture d'un projet

4) d'appréhender la dimension créative du code en général

5) d'apprendre à mettre en place des stratégies pour mener un projet

Face à une population d'élèves qui ont quitté le tronc commun, et pour qui les études classiques sont souvent un problème (les maths en particulier, l'orthographe, la logique aussi), je tente de mettre au point une méthode qui sort des sentiers battus, plus proche des attentes et des mécanismes de ces jeunes.

Dans le cadre de ce mémoire, je recherche des exemples de cours de programmation dispensés dans n'importe quel domaine, histoire de faire un bilan des méthodes eprouvées (ou pas) dans l'enseignement de la programmation.

Je sais que quelques enseignants et formateurs trainent sur le HUB, tout comme certains étudiants en webdesign. Je leur serais très reconnaissant si tous pouvaient me fournir un exemple de support de cours (plutot de niveau débutant), afin que j'étudie et dresse une typologie. Nous avons tous eu des profs totalement abscons, des supports de cours insondables et des blocages persistants :lol:

Je m'en remets à vous et à vos souvenirs (ou votre actualité) pour alimenter cette étude intéressante et d'actualité ! Si vous avez sous la main tout type de document pédagogique sur la programmation, je suis preneur. Vous pouvez m'envoyer ça brut de décoffrage sur mon mail ! Tout témoignage dans ce post de vos expériences est aussi le bienvenu !

En vous remerciant de m'avoir lu, et dans l'attente de pistes intéressantes, je retourne à mes cours :)

Modifié par Commmint
Posté

triste a dire, je n ai jamais reñcontre un cours sur la programatioñ bieñ foutu :nono:

pourtañt j ai teste des ateliers prives puis la fac puis uñe ecole

Posté

Bonjour Commmint, un petit caillou à ton édifice.

Et bien, j'ai fais de la formation chez un grand constructeur, mais malheuresement pour un public averti. Mais il y a plus de dix ans, j'ai aussi donné une formation de démystification de l'outil informatique à des utilisateurs non informatiiciens. Voici le parallèle que j'ai utilisé et qui a d'ailleurs très bien marché :

Un ordinateur c'est "comme" un taxi :

TAXI vs Ordinateur

la voiture / la machine

le chauffeur / le logiciel système d'exploitation

la voiture seule ne mène nul part, le PC seul ne peut rien faire.

Le chaufeur fait fonctionner la voiture, il prend les courses à faire.

Le système d'exploitation fait fonctionner le PC, il interprête les commandes de l'utiilisateur.

Le chauffeur est l'interface entre le client et la voiture, le système d'exploitation est l'interface entre l'utilisateur et la machine.

Ensuite, le chauffeur à besoin de cartes et d'un carnet de RDV.

Les cartes sont les CDROM que l'on peut mettre dans le PC,

Le carnet de RDV est le disque dur où l'on stocke des informations.

Il y a plus de dix, il n'y avait pas d'Internet, mais aujourd'hui on pourrait ajouter que l'ordinateur communique avec d'autres comme le chauffeur communique avec son centre d'appels.

Enfin, voilà, une idée qui pourra peut-être te servir.

Si tu veux quelque chose de plus lisible je peux te faire un tableau récapitulatif avec tout ce qui me passe par la tête, on peut aller assez loin avec cette métaphore.

En ce qui concerne la programmation, je pense qu'on pourrait prendre une usine et des ouvriers pour monter un parallèle. L'usine serait l'objet (le but) du programme, les ouvriers seraient les routines du programmes, reste à trouver l'histoire ...

Si vraiment tu veux, je peux essayer de te concocter un petit qq chose dans ce sens. En prennant des fonctions basiques de la programation. Peut-être qu'une entreprise de fabrication de maison pourrait faire l'affaire.

Bonne chance.

Nils.

Veuillez vous connecter pour commenter

Vous pourrez laisser un commentaire après vous êtes connecté.



Connectez-vous maintenant
×
×
  • Créer...